Vladimír Socha
(born 1 January 1982 in
Hradec Králové
) is a
Czech
writer, publisher, public lecturer and science promoter from the city of
Hradec Králové
(north-eastern
Czech Republic
). His main interest lies in
dinosaur
paleontology
and the
history of science
in general. So far, he published fifteen books about dinosaurs and primeval life in
Czech
, six smaller brochures (booklets) and many magazine articles about
nature
, history and
prehistory
. In 2009 he volunteered in the summer paleontological field dig in the
Hell Creek formation
in eastern
Montana
(for the ''
Museum of the Rockies
'' in
Bozeman
). A year later, he published a book about the experience called ''Dinosauři od Pekelného potoka'' (
Dinosaurs from the Hell Creek
). He also provides interviews for the
Czech Radio
and sometimes organises
paleoart
exhibitions.
